Transaction 249bd8408c8ce80ac79f4e04676c678c5f871799e7f8563a93cc54c0b6a9d679
1 Input
1 Outputs
- 249bd8408c8ce80ac79f4e04676c678c5f871799e7f8563a93cc54c0b6a9d679:0
value 38705
address 1Pe9R3QQVNjgayVVgyBmNmtB6YMmrf9ie9